What F3 Means
On a standalone Kenmore wall oven built on the same Whirlpool electronic-range control platform, F3 flags the identical oven temperature-sensor fault seen on Kenmore ranges — the sensor circuit is reading open or shorted, and the oven stops heating rather than risk an inaccurate bake.
Common Causes of F3
- Failed or drifting temperature sensor (RTD probe)
- Damaged sensor wiring harness behind the cavity
- Control board misreading the sensor signal
🔧 One Safe Check You Can Try
Power-cycle at the breaker for a couple of minutes; if F3 reappears on the next bake attempt, that confirms a genuine sensor-circuit fault rather than a one-time glitch.
⚠ Why You Shouldn't Go Further Than That
- The sensor sits inside the hot cavity, wired directly into the control board — testing it live risks both a shock and a burn.
- On a double wall oven, the two cavities can share part of the same control architecture, so incorrect wiring work on one side can affect the other.
- A sensor swapped without confirming the wiring harness is intact can leave the exact same code active after the part is replaced.
- Panel access behind the cavity typically involves disassembly that voids remaining parts coverage.
